Energy Assistance

Energy Assistance Program (EAP) helps eligible households maintain affordable, continuous, and safe home energy. Our services include bill payment assistance, home energy crisis intervention, outreach, energy advocacy, information about utility consumer rights, and referrals.

Energy Assistance is a program that is designed to assist income-eligible households with the cost of energy/heating their homes. Everyone deserves affordable, continuous, and safe home energy services. If you encounter difficulties with home heating and/or electricity, we can help you with assistance with your bill, crisis benefits, and furnace repair/replacements (for homeowners). In addition, we can provide information about utility consumer rights and referrals to our Energy Conservation services and other community agencies.

Many Minnesotans spend over 25% of their income on utility bills. Do you need help with your heating or electric bills? WCCA is here to help!

Eligibility Information

The Energy Assistance Program is available to any Minnesota resident who is a homeowner or renter in Wright County.

  • Renters and homeowners are eligible.
  • Assets such as the home are not considered in determining eligibility.
  • Grants can be up to $1,400, based on household size, income, & fuel cost.
  • The average grant is about $500.

In addition to the initial grant, additional Crisis funds are available to help pay a past-due bill or get an emergency fuel delivery. There is also the ability to help homeowners get their broken furnaces repaired or replaced. Please contact WCCA to inquire. If you qualify for EAP, you may qualify for Weatherization services or other essential energy-related repairs as well.

Eligibility guidelines are revised yearly.
